Two people died in Magadan as a result of a fire in a private house.
In Magadan, two people died due to a fire in a private house on April 7. This was announced on April 8 by the press service of the Main Directorate of the Ministry of Emergency Situations of Russia in the Magadan region in Moscow.
"The tragedy occurred <...> in 3rd Transport lane. The first units arrived at the extinguishing site seven minutes after the call," the report says.
It is specified that by the time of arrival the wooden building was on fire. During the extinguishing of the fire, employees of the gas and smoke protection service found the bodies of a man and a woman in the house.
"Firefighters evacuated five people from a neighboring house. One of the victims with a mild degree of carbon monoxide poisoning was handed over to the ambulance crew," the press service of the department reported.
The Ministry of Emergency Situations added that the fire area was 63 square meters, 34 people and nine pieces of equipment were involved in extinguishing.
